Job Summary: The Registered Veterinary Technician provides leadership and training to the medical support staff in the operation of a small animal facility in accordance with hospital policy and procedures and provides medical care to patients as allowed in the veterinary practice act. The Registered Veterinary Technician will be able to communicate effectively with team members and clients and have great attention to detail and organizational abilities.

Responsibilities

Essential Functions:

The following duties and responsibilities generally reflect the expectations of this job but are not intended to be all inclusive. The essential functions include the most significant tasks and are the essence of why the role exists; removing an essential duty would fundamentally alter the role.

  • Maintain and uphold Core Values and Mission Statement of MVP.
  • Provide guidance to the support staff to assure that the shift flows well.
  • Mentor team members for career advancement and personal development towards goals.
  • Provide input to the hospital manager for 360-degree employee performance evaluations.
  • Provide patient care under the supervision and direction of a DVM.
  • Maintain excellent client communication.
  • Record all pertinent medical, client and case related information in the patient record accurately with appropriate grammar, terms, and accurate information.
  • Review medical records, estimates or discharge instructions with clients.
  • Answer client’s inquiries about basic animal care questions and routine procedures; handle client’s medical questions with confidence and direct to veterinarians when appropriate.
